Output 51b82fc71f34fd9efcfe1e25a349bab28bf6ca9ac8ff6b66b2615949e1d1916b:1

value
2035325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86039ee1b1263ce1debe6c1df5e3d164a1b882ea OP_EQUALVERIFY OP_CHECKSIG
address
1DDbtGj9HD3a7EjZY9Hy4bUVT3VqTGEMQM
transaction
51b82fc71f34fd9efcfe1e25a349bab28bf6ca9ac8ff6b66b2615949e1d1916b
spent
true